<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 手機與無(wú)線(xiàn)通信 > 業(yè)界動(dòng)態(tài) > 華為溝通會(huì ):“嚇人的”GPU Turbo技術(shù)核心思路公開(kāi)

華為溝通會(huì ):“嚇人的”GPU Turbo技術(shù)核心思路公開(kāi)

作者: 時(shí)間:2018-06-15 來(lái)源:新浪手機 收藏

  6月14日上午消息,近兩周?chē)@余承東口中“嚇人的技術(shù)”圖形處理技術(shù)外界有著(zhù)許多猜測與解讀?;诖?,召開(kāi)了一場(chǎng)EMUI主題溝通會(huì )。從系統到新技術(shù)做了講解。

本文引用地址:http://dyxdggzs.com/article/201806/381699.htm

  一、是個(gè)多層級的梳理技術(shù)

  首先是數據上的一些分享,目前EMUI的日活用戶(hù)接近3.4億人;為老機型用戶(hù)提供EMUI 8.0的用戶(hù)數達到了8000萬(wàn)。而站在發(fā)展歷史角度,EMUI 5.0則是內部對系統的分水嶺。


GPU Trubo技術(shù)講解

  技術(shù)講解

  談到優(yōu)化,就不得不分層講解:手機由硬件底層到可以看到的系統,由內到外分為硬件、內核、驅動(dòng)、配套、中間件和框架層。因為安卓開(kāi)源的問(wèn)題,沒(méi)層里面都彼此混亂,應用調用的代碼層級不同、無(wú)用代碼、同一個(gè)數據調用位置不一樣,這些都是巨大的耗損。

  就好比糯米諾骨牌,這些環(huán)節層層相連,哪個(gè)環(huán)節出問(wèn)題都不能達到流暢。

  華為說(shuō)的GPU Turbo,就是針對完整的一套優(yōu)化,而中間層由于代碼量最大、最為混亂的部分,也是優(yōu)化的主要位置。譬如在EMUI 4.0時(shí)代華為做了SensorHub LiteOS層面整理、EMUI 5.0時(shí)代則完成了虛擬機、數據庫、文件系統以及Ultra Memory的優(yōu)化。

  到了EMUI 8.0時(shí)代,優(yōu)化則涉及iAware,人工智能、機器學(xué)習、資源分組調用等。這些共同構成了GPU Turbo,比如一個(gè)游戲應用在調用不同層級的數據,發(fā)覺(jué)這一幀與下一陣畫(huà)面的變化只有20%,所以只需要做20%內容的處理。

  而在整體梳理以前,則需要完全渲染一幀畫(huà)面。


GPU Trubo技術(shù)講解

  GPU Turbo技術(shù)講解

  完成這些優(yōu)化需要的是大量的數據測試,華為設有武漢中端軟件自動(dòng)化測試中心、北京中端開(kāi)放實(shí)驗室、北京終端軟件自動(dòng)化測試中心,每個(gè)測試中心都有大量手機在做24小時(shí)的測試運行。這些數據是EMUI優(yōu)化的基礎。

  二、建立應用的生態(tài)

  開(kāi)放是優(yōu)化的另一個(gè)思路,華為擁有終端實(shí)驗室Openlab。這一平臺針對第三方應用開(kāi)發(fā)者,他們不需要購買(mǎi)華為終端,只需要在這個(gè)平臺上,就能做和手機的適配與優(yōu)化。目前能實(shí)現為第三方開(kāi)發(fā)者提供應用遠程調試優(yōu)化的標準,評測維度包括安全、穩定、兼容性、等五大標準。開(kāi)發(fā)者的應用是否完整好用,用Openlab就能得到答案。

  相應的,一方面這些應用會(huì )對華為以及安卓手機有更好的適配;反過(guò)來(lái),華為也能更好地了解新的應用趨勢,儲備數據。


GPU Trubo技術(shù)講解

  GPU Turbo技術(shù)講解

  華為還把這種思路放到了AI平臺,稱(chēng)之為HiAI平臺。運用獨有NPU的技術(shù),開(kāi)放DDK給第三方應用,讓?xiě)玫倪\行效率更高?,F場(chǎng)展示了Prisma、WPS等圖片處理軟件,利用NPU和AI在圖形處理上的優(yōu)勢,其渲染圖片會(huì )快很多。

  并且華為在現場(chǎng)還宣布會(huì )在6.22和6.23召開(kāi)“2018華為終端。全球合作伙伴及開(kāi)發(fā)者大會(huì )”,數據梳理、生態(tài)、閉環(huán)、似乎是華為在OS層面的下一步。

  新浪手機點(diǎn)評:GPU Turbo在發(fā)稿前的熱議關(guān)鍵在于“沒(méi)人能一針見(jiàn)血說(shuō)出技術(shù)原理”,今天的溝通會(huì )不僅解釋了原理,更是解開(kāi)了疑惑。顯然圖形處理加速是系統和硬件多年共同優(yōu)化的結果,想簡(jiǎn)單概括確實(shí)并不容易。


GPU Trubo技術(shù)講解

  GPU Turbo技術(shù)講解

  會(huì )上另一個(gè)關(guān)鍵點(diǎn)是華為把這種生態(tài)數據的梳理運用到了多方面:Openlab和HiAI兩個(gè)平臺就是把自身硬件和第三方數據適配的兩個(gè)環(huán)節。這思路其實(shí)并不新鮮,蘋(píng)果iOS的優(yōu)秀體驗本身就來(lái)閉環(huán)生態(tài);而安卓開(kāi)放留下的軟肋,就留給了手機廠(chǎng)商自己。



關(guān)鍵詞: 華為 GPU Turbo

評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>